Campus Lockdown
  • When notified of a potential threat, all officers and backup officers respond; other agencies are contacted immediately as required. Residential and academic buildings can be locked down by computer; students and staff are still able to card into locked buildings for protection.
  • Students and staff are encouraged to sign up for FlashNews, a free email or cell phone emergency notification program, which also includes weather closure information. A message will be sent anytime Willamette University adds a notification to FlashNews; you may choose to receive messages from other local emergency service agencies. Go to FlashAlert to enroll.
  • Additional plans in process:
    • A siren, audible across the entire campus, will broadcast specific instructions on where to go or stay for protection in case of a campus emergency.
    • A computer program capable of locking a group of buildings in about 10 seconds.
